What Is Solar Arrays in Photovoltaic Systems


To maximize solar power generation, it’s crucial to understand what a solar array is and how it differs from units like strings, modules, and cells. This guide explains the structure and role of arrays, how they impact energy output, their relation to system conversion efficiency, and key design considerations.


What Is a Solar Array?

A solar array is the largest unit in a photovoltaic system. It consists of multiple solar modules connected either in series or parallel. The array directly determines the system’s total generation capacity.


🧩 Key Unit Differences: Cell, Module, String, Array

Cell

The most basic unit, a solar cell is typically about 10 cm square. It generates electricity directly from sunlight but outputs only ~0.5W and 0.5V–0.6V. Cells are made using crystalline silicon wafers with PN junctions.

Module

A module combines many cells, protected by glass, EVA, and aluminum frames—commonly known as a solar panel. Modules vary in size and are designed to be weatherproof.

String

A string is a set of modules connected in series to increase voltage. Proper string design is essential for minimizing energy loss.

Array

An array is a complete structure of multiple strings, forming the main solar-generating unit.


How Much Power Can an Array Produce?

The array’s output is calculated by:

Module Wattage × Number of Modules

For example:

180W module × 20 pcs = 3,600W (3.6kW)

The larger the array, the greater the energy it can generate. However, the output is DC and must be converted to AC via a power conditioner (inverter), which introduces conversion losses.


🔋 Maximize Array Output: 3 Essential Tips

1. Optimal Tilt Angle

The ideal angle lets sunlight hit the panels perpendicularly, minimizing reflection and maximizing efficiency.

2. Orientation

In Japan, south-facing arrays are optimal to track the sun from morning to evening.

3. String Configuration

Uniform module counts in each string and shadow management are essential to avoid reduced output.


Solar Arrays and System Conversion Efficiency

What Is System Conversion Efficiency?

This measures how well a solar system converts sunlight into usable AC electricity.

Formula:

(AC Output Energy) ÷ (Solar Irradiance × Array Area)

If 1000W of sunlight hits the array and the inverter outputs 200W of AC power:

Efficiency = 200 ÷ 1000 = 20%

Array Efficiency vs. System Efficiency

  • Array Efficiency: DC power output from sunlight per square meter.
  • System Efficiency: Takes into account inverter loss, cable loss, and weather conditions.

Monitoring both allows early detection of underperforming components.


3 Key Points in Effective Array Design

H3. Tilt Angle

Affects how directly sunlight hits the module surface. In Japan, a 30° tilt is commonly optimal but may vary by region.

H3. Orientation

South-facing is ideal. If that’s not feasible, aim for the closest angle to south.

H3. String Design

Unbalanced strings or shading on one module can reduce overall output. Smart string planning mitigates this.


Final Thoughts: Understand Units to Design Efficient Systems

A strong grasp of arrays, strings, modules, and cells is the foundation of efficient solar system design. Applying principles like correct orientation, tilt, and balanced strings will enhance both array and overall system efficiency.
